սրտառիմ (Old Armenian) comes from Old Armenian առնում, from Proto-Indo-European h₂r-nu-, from Proto-Indo-European h₂er- — to fit, to fix, to put together.
սրտառիմ (Old Armenian): to take to heart, to get angry, to chafe
